Mike's Special BBQ Sauce


I didn't have any BBQ sauce on hand one time and decided to make my own with ingredients that  I had at hand. I first used it on grilled BBQ chicken wings but found that it went well with any grilled or smoked meat. It has always been a hit with my family. This recipe makes about 1/2 cup.


Ingredients

4 Tablespoons ketchup

1 Tablespoon Worcestershire sauce

1 Tablespoon maple syrup

1 Tablespoon apple cider vinegar

1 teaspoon honey

1 teaspoon toasted sesame seed oil

1 teaspoon ground black pepper

1 teaspoon garlic powder

1-2 dashes of Tabasco sauce


Directions

Combine all ingredients in a small bowl and mix well.

I usually taste and add more of whatever is needed.


For a variation once, I tried soy sauce in place of the Worcestershire sauce - also very good!
